Best Quotes about Courage

1.
Let bravery be thy choice, but not bravado.
Menander

2.
Some have been thought brave because they didn't have the courage to run away.
Proverb

3.
It is amidst great perils we see brave hearts.
Regnard, Jean Francois

4.
The bravest are the most tender; the loving are the daring.
Taylor, Bayard

5.
A timid person is frightened before a danger, a coward during the time, and a courageous person afterward.
Jean Paul Richter

6.
With your help I can advance against a troop; with my God I can scale a wall. [Psalms 18:29]
Bible

7.
Last, but by no means least, courage-moral courage, the courage of one's convictions, the courage to see things through. The world ;is in a constant conspiracy against the brave. It's the age-old struggle-the roar of the crowd on one side and the voice of your ;conscience on the other.
Macarthur, Douglas

8.
Fortune and love favor the brave.
Ovid

9.
It is in great dangers that we see great courage.
Regnard, Jean Francois

10.
Wealth lost is something lost, honor lost is something lost: Courage lost all is lost.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

11.
The more thou dost advance, the more thy feet pitfalls will meet. The Path that leadeth on is lighted by one fire -- the light of daring burning in the heart. The more one dares, the more he shall obtain. The more he fears, the more that light shall pale
Blavatsky, Helena Petrova

12.
To have courage for whatever comes in life -- everything lies in that.
Teresa of Avila, St.

13.
Private bravery is often the price of personal victory.

14.
Discoveries are often made by not following instructions, by going off the main road, by trying the untried.
Tyger, Frank

15.
One who never turned his back but marched breast forward, never doubted clouds would break, Never dreamed, though right were worsted, wrong would triumph,
Browning, Robert

16.
To boldly go where no man has gone before.
TV series, Star Trek

17.
Stand up to crises. Don't let them throw you! Fight to stay calm... even surmount the crisis completely and turn it into an opportunity. Refuse to renounce your self-image. No matter what happens, you must keep your good opinion of yourself. No matter what happens, you must hold your past successes in your imagination, ready for showing in the motion picture screen of your mind. No matter what happens, no matter what you lose, no matter what failures you must endure, you must keep faith in yourself. Then you can stand up to crises, with calm and courage, refusing to buckle; then you will not fall through the floor. You will be able to support yourself.
Maltz, Maxwell

18.
Anybody with a little guts and the desire to apply himself can make it, he can make anything he wants to make of himself.
Shoemaker, Willie

19.
Stride forward with a firm, steady step knowing with a deep, certain inner knowing that you will reach every goal you set yourselves, that you will achieve every aim .
Caddy, Eileen

20.
Courage is not simply one of the virtues but the form of every virtue at the testing point, which means at the point of highest reality.
Lewis, C. S.

21.
Write on your doors the saying wise and old. Be bold! and everywhere -- Be bold; Be not too bold! Yet better the excess Than the defect; better the more than less sustaineth him and the steadiness of his mind beareth him out.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th

22.
A great deal of talent is lost in the world for want of courage.
Smith, Sydney

23.
Have the courage to say no. Have the courage to face the truth. Do the right thing because it is right. These are the magic keys to living your life with integrity.
Stone, W. Clement

24.
It's better to be a lion for a day, than a sheep all your life.
Kenny, Sister Elizabeth

25.
No one can be brave who considers pain to be the greatest evil in life, or can they be temperate who considers pleasure to be the highest good.
Cicero, Marcus T.

26.
Gallantry to women -- the sure road to their favor -- is nothing but the appearance of extreme devotion to all their wants and wishes, a delight in their satisfaction, and a confidence in yourself as being able to contribute toward it.
Hazlitt, William

27.
Half a man's wisdom goes with his courage.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

28.
We are made strong by the difficulties we face not by those we evade.

29.
It takes a certain courage and a certain greatness to be truly base.
Anouilh, Jean

30.
It shows a brave and resolute spirit not to be agitated in exciting circumstances.
Cicero, Marcus T.

31.
True courage is cool and calm. The bravest of men have the least of a brutal, bullying insolence, and in the very time of danger are found the most serene and free.
Shaftesbury, Lord

32.
Though the practice of chivalry fell even more sadly short of its theoretic standard than practice generally falls below theory, it remains one of the most precious monuments of the moral history of our race, as a remarkable instance of a concerted and organized attempt by a most disorganized and distracted society, to raise up and carry into practice a moral ideal greatly in advance of its social condition and institutions; so much so as to have been completely frustrated in the main object, yet never entirely inefficacious, and which has left a most sensible, and for the most part a highly valuable impress on the ideas and feelings of all subsequent times.
Mill, John Stuart

33.
Grant what thou commandest and then command what thou wilt.
Augustine, St.

34.
You are merely not feeling equal to the tasks before you.
Carnegie, Dale

35.
Bravery is the capacity to perform properly even when scared half to death.
Bradley, Omar

36.
The finest gift you can give anyone is encouragement. Yet, almost no one gets the encouragement they need to grow to their full potential. If everyone received the encouragement they need to grow, the genius in most everyone would blossom and the world would produce abundance beyond the wildest dreams. We would have more than one Einstein, Edison, Schweitzer, Mother Theresa, Dr. Salk and other great minds in a century.
Madwed, Sidney

37.
Life only demands from you the strength that you possess. Only one feat is possible; not to run away.
Hammarskjold, Dag

38.
Correction does much, but encouragement does more. Encouragement after censure is as the sun after a shower.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

39.
Courage is a special kind of knowledge: the knowledge of how to fear what ought to be feared and how not to fear what ought no to be feared.
Ben-Gurion, David

40.
Courage is poorly housed that dwells in numbers; the lion never counts the herd that are about him, nor weighs how many flocks he has to scatter.
Hill, Aaron

41.
Act boldly and unseen forces will come to your aid.
Brande, Dorothea

42.
Courage is the ladder on which all the other virtues mount.
Clare Booth Luce

43.
I'd rather give my life than be afraid to give it.
Johnson, Lyndon B.

44.
Courage is fire, and bullying is smoke.
Disraeli, Benjamin

45.
When you meet your antagonist, do everything in a mild and agreeable manner. Let your courage be as keen, but at the same time as polished, as your sword.
Richard Brinsley Sheridan

46.
We can never be certain of our courage until we have faced danger.
La Rochefoucauld, Francois De

47.
The scars you acquire while exercising courage will never make you feel inferior.
Battista, D.A.

48.
Moral courage is a more rare commodity than bravery in battle or great intelligence.
Kennedy, Robert F.

49.
It takes a lot of courage to show your dreams to someone else.
Bombeck, Erma

50.
Success is never final and failure is never fatal. It's courage that counts.
Ellinger, Jules
